Questions and Answers

Do I need a permit to replace my water heater or pipes in Adrian?

Most substantial plumbing work in Nobles County requires a permit from the Building and Zoning office, and it must be performed by a contractor licensed with the Minnesota Department of Labor and Industry. As a master plumber, I pull those permits, schedule the required inspections, and ensure the work meets all state and local codes. Handling that red tape is part of the job, so you don't have to navigate the paperwork yourself.

What's the most important spring plumbing task for an Adrian home?

Before the spring thaw hits its peak, disconnect any garden hoses and ensure your exterior hose bibs are fully drained and shut off from inside. A hose left connected traps water in the bib; when overnight temps still dip near 6 degrees, that trapped water freezes and splits the pipe inside your wall. This simple, five-minute preventative step avoids a costly repair to your home's plumbing structure every year.

Could the flat land around Adrian cause drainage issues for my plumbing?

The plain terrain here lacks the natural slope for gravity to assist with drainage. Around Adrian City Park and similar areas, this can lead to water pooling near foundation walls and sewer line cleanouts. Over time, that saturated soil puts constant, even pressure on your main sewer line, which can cause the pipe to sag or the joints to separate, creating a prime spot for roots to invade or for blockages to form.

Is my plumbing different living in rural Adrian versus in town?

The core materials are often the same era of galvanized steel, but the systems differ. Homes on private wells and septic systems outside city limits have added components like well pumps, pressure tanks, and septic fields that require specific maintenance. Water pressure is controlled by your pump setting, not the municipal supply, and septic system care is critical to avoid backups, which is a different protocol than a city sewer connection.

Does Adrian's hard water damage my water heater?

Yes, the mineral content from our municipal wells accelerates scale buildup inside appliances. In a water heater, this sediment settles at the bottom, insulating the burner element and causing it to overwork and fail prematurely. You'll hear more rumbling and popping noises, see a drop in hot water supply, and face higher energy bills. An annual flush of the tank can mitigate this, but the hard water here makes it a necessary maintenance task.

Why do my galvanized pipes keep springing leaks?

Galvanized steel pipes from the 1950s fail from the inside out. Decades of mineral scale buildup and rust slowly choke the pipe's diameter, creating increased pressure on the weakened walls. This leads to pinhole leaks, most commonly at the threaded joints where the protective zinc coating was compromised during installation. Once one joint starts weeping, others nearby are often under similar stress and will follow.
